Rotary phone collects 'Stories of Humanity' at St. Pete park

Published August 24, 2026 4:34 PM EDT

Long before texting dominated daily communication, reaching someone often required picking up the phone and leaving a voicemail. 

Jenny Hogan is reviving that in an effort to help people slow down and connect, she said.

The backstory:

Hogan started the Instagram page Stories of Humanity almost a year ago, profiling people and their stories from across the area.  

"I recognized that with the people that I was meeting, they had such deep and beautiful stories that they were sharing with me and I wanted a way to encapsulate some of these stories and showcase some of the stories with my love of documentation and storytelling," she said. "Being a therapist myself, I absolutely love humans and the mosaic of stories that come to create who they are as a human."

What we know:

She has now introduced a new concept called "Leave a Message After the Tone." Hogan regularly places a rotary phone in Elva Rouse Park near Vinoy Park, inviting anyone walking past to pick up the phone and share whatever is on their mind.

What they're saying:

"Through all of the interviews that I've done with Stories of Humanity, I recognized that there are some people who don't feel entirely comfortable sharing their story in video format on the page. And, I wanted there to be a way that people could share little tidbits about their life or deep stories about themselves in a way that felt more private and kind of honored maybe that boundary that they have for themselves and also a way to kind of capture the little moments, you know, as somebody is walking through the park and reflecting on their life or reflecting on that day to where we can encapsulate some of those moments," Hogan said.

To help prompt reflection, Hogan occasionally places a sign beside the telephone featuring a specific question or theme. The device records the audio, and selected voicemails are later posted to the project's social media pages.

What's next:

The phone will continue to pop up at various locations throughout Vinoy Park. Scheduling updates and location details are published on the Stories of Humanity Instagram page.
